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3052 35 983124336 15270675 060539550
332394 78041242
332394 78041242
7816412768 5200802 77925692
All about undefined
Interested in learning more?
332394 78041242
7816412768 5200802 77925692
See more
011112 329 685777
62709 29676267273 48166034272
See more
4996 22477417596 86
13796565 19 01 88638304530
See more